West Asia developments, Fed minutes to shape bullions next move: Analysts
Gold and silver prices are expected to remain positive next week, although elevated volatility is likely to persist amid developments in West Asia and key global economic data, analysts said. Market participants will track US housing and trade data, inflation figures from the UK, Eurozone, and Japan, as well as China's economic indicators for cues on industrial metals. The minutes of the Federal Reserve's FOMC meeting will also be watched for signals on the US Central bank's monetary policy outlook, they added. "The outlook for gold and silver remains positive and are expected to move up towards Rs 1.57 lakh per 10 grams and Rs 2.54 lakh per kg level," Pranav Mer, Senior Vice President, EBG - Commodity & Currency Research, JM Financial Services Ltd, said. On the domestic front, gold futures for October delivery climbed Rs 2,686, or nearly 2 per cent, last week to close at Rs 1.54 lakh per 10 grams on the Multi Commodity Exchange (MCX).
